How to troubleshoot your device for freezing?
Troubleshoot your device for freezing 1 Press and hold your device’s power button. 2 On your screen, touch and hold Power off. Tap OK. 3 After you see ‘Safe mode’ at the bottom of your screen, wait to see if the problem goes away.

Why is my app running slow and freezing?
Over some period of time, the cache will pile up, and you may notice the app is running slow or freezing or crashing frequently. That often happens when we are using some of the most popular apps such as Facebook, Viber, Instagram, Spotify, Maps, Messanger, WhatsApp, etc.
